Website fingerprinting enables a local eavesdropper to determine which websites a user is visiting over an encrypted connection and can even reveal information sent over the Tor anonymity system. In this work, we present Deep Fingerprinting (DF), a new website fingerprinting attack against Tor that leverages a type of deep learning called Convolutional Neural Networks (CNN). The DF attack attains over 98% accuracy on Tor traffic and can even defeat some recently proposed defenses against website fingerprinting. The success of this attack shows the value of deep learning techniques in security applications.
